We are delighted to host Paula Duarte in Leeds!
A day to move, connect, and let your inner tango goddess shine.
Both roles welcome!
Join Paula Duarte in Leeds for a special afternoon, where you will be rediscovering tango, deepening technical understanding, and improving the relationship with your own body.
This signature workshop is designed for dancers who want to connect more deeply with themselves and others, enhance their technical understanding, increase self-awareness, build self-confidence, and attune to their own power.
What’s happening on the day?
We’ll start by coming together in a shared circle, creating a space to safely open the day and connect with ourselves and with each other before stepping onto the dance floor. From there, the day will unfold through a beautiful mix of technical and somatic work designed to bring balance, presence and technical clarity.

Sessions

Programme Saturday 31.01.2026:
1. Opening Circle & Sharing with a Partner
Exercises to gently opening the day to ground, connect, break the ice and and tune into your own body.
2. Somatic Exercises
Simple but powerful body-awareness practices to release tension and open up natural movement, preparing the body and mind for the chore of the workshop.
3. Walking Technique
A complete technical breakdown of the walk, one of the most important elements of the Argentine Tango for elegance, precision, comfort, stability and connection with partners.
4.Ochos, Spirals & circularity
Understand the principles of dissociation, how to increase range of rotation, while maintaining stability.
Learn how to apply these concepts practically and contextually.
5.Giros & Turns
Deconstructing one of the most technically rich figures of the Argentine Tango. Understand how to turn around your partner effortlessly.
Break
6. Standing leg versus free leg
Understanding the roles of the standing leg and free leg, for solid stability, styling and decorations.
7. Melodic Decorations
Exploring melodical decorations, increasing control of the body, applying different variations in the proper music context and learning how to best communicate your needs with the leader when requesting time is needed
8. Rhythmic Decorations
Connect with your playful side by exploring rhythmic decorations and variations, adding personality to your dance and obtaining confident styling options for the dance floor.
9.Somatic Closing & Relaxation
Coming back to the body, integrating everything we’ve learned with breath, stillness, and presence.
​10. Closing the circle
We’ll end the day together in a circle of sharing and gratitude, celebrating what we’ve discovered on the dance floor.
